Egyptian Pres Abdel Fattah el-Sisi issues law that allows him to deport non-Egyptians convicted of crimes to their home countries; move could lead to release of Peter Greste, one of three journalists from Al Jazeera English news channel who have been imprisoned for almost a year.

Chinese Pres Xi Jinping, during news conference with Pres Obama, appears to draw link between unfavorable coverage of his government and visa access problems for reporters; comments confirm suspicions that Beijing punishes journalists it does not like by miring visa requests in bureaucracy or declining them.

News analysis; Beijing news conference between Pres Xi Jinping and Pres Obama, during which Xi abandons platitudes to warn Western world not to meddle in China's affairs, provides riveting example of why relationship between United States and China remains one of world's most complicated; countries' determination to work together belies deep-rooted historical grievances and fierce rivalry.

Editorial cites Chinese Pres Xi Jinping's disinclination to ease visa restrictions for foreign journalists; responds by asserting that the New York Times will not alter its coverage to suit his whims or those of any other government leader; holds a confident regime should be able to handle truthful examination and criticism.
